Transponder keys

Transponder keys are a common feature in a lot of modern cars. Car thieves are always looking for new ways to rob a vehicle. This type of key is a popular feature in many modern cars and can make it harder for thieves to wire the vehicle. However it doesn't mean the vehicle is impervious to theft, as thieves can still use their tools to complete the task. Transponder keys remain an attractive alternative for those concerned about theft of cars.

The main distinction between a regular car key and a remote car key is that the former uses a traditional mechanical key, and the latter features a microchip inside it. This microchip is an electronic device that transmits information about the key to the computer of the car. The microchip is also designed to stop the car from starting when the wrong key is used. Unlike the traditional key one, a transponder key can't be duplicated with a standard key cutter but it can be copied with special equipment.

You can purchase an additional transponder-based key through your auto locksmith or dealer. The cost can vary but usually ranges between $220 to $475. You might have to pay extra for the modification of your key to fit your car. The most expensive keys are those that combine the remote and the key into one unit, such as the Fobik key that is used in Chrysler cars, or the proximity key found in Mercedes and Infiniti.

Consult a local automotive technician if you are looking to replace the keys on your Audi. This will ensure that the replacement key is programmed to start your car. This process is very complex and requires a special programing tool.

Certain keys are marked "do not duplicate," which means that it's illegal to make copies get more info without the permission click here of the original owner. This is typically done for security purposes and serves as a security measure against theft and unauthorised entry. A majority of chain hardware stores do not cut these kinds of keys because they don't want to take on responsibility in the event the copied keys are misused by someone else. It doesn't mean that they aren't cut; however, it might require more time from a locksmith and knowledge.
